1. Why Hotel Chains Are Standardizing Their RFP Formats

The global RFP process had long been fragmented, with inconsistent data formats and complex rate verification

processes. In 2025, hotel groups are unifying their submission frameworks to ensure smoother data exchange

and compliance verification.

The Core Objectives Behind the Change:

  • Consistency Across Regions: One universal RFP structure for all markets.

  • Digital Integration: Easy import/export between sourcing tools and chain databases.

  • Transparency: Unified scoring for sustainability and rate accuracy.

  • Compliance: Standardized documentation for ESG and data privacy.

3. Enhanced Sustainability and ESG Disclosure Requirements

A major update for 2025 is the integration of sustainability scoring into RFP evaluations. Hotel chains are now

required to disclose ESG data such as carbon footprint, energy consumption, and social responsibility initiatives.

5. The Rise of Continuous Contracting and Re-Bidding

Instead of annual bidding cycles, hotels now encourage dynamic sourcing, allowing buyers to update their

contracts mid-year based on market trends. This requires powerful, adaptable sourcing technology capable of

managing rolling negotiations.
